要在SwiftUI中創建自定義形狀,您可以使用Path和Shape結構體。下面是一個簡單的示例,演示如何創建一個自定義的星形狀: import SwiftUI struct Star: Shape
在SwiftUI中,您可以使用Gesture來實現手勢識別。下面是一個簡單的示例,展示如何在SwiftUI中實現手勢識別: import SwiftUI struct ContentView: Vi
在SwiftUI中使用Core Data進行數據持久化的步驟如下: 創建一個Core Data模型文件:在Xcode中創建一個新的Data Model文件,定義你的數據模型。 創建一個Core
在SwiftUI中實現深色模式和淺色模式可以通過使用ColorScheme來實現。ColorScheme是一個枚舉類型,用來表示當前的顏色方案,包括淺色(Light)和深色(Dark)。 在Swift
是的,SwiftUI 支持自定義字體。您可以使用自定義字體來設置文本視圖或任何其他需要字體的地方。為了使用自定義字體,您需要將字體文件添加到項目中,并在 SwiftUI 視圖中使用自定義字體的名稱。以
在SwiftUI中創建自定義動畫可以通過使用自定義的動畫修飾符和動畫函數來實現。下面是一個簡單示例,展示如何創建一個自定義的彈簧效果動畫: import SwiftUI struct CustomS
在SwiftUI中實現多語言支持可以通過使用SwiftUI的內置功能來實現。下面是一種常見的方法: 創建Localizable.strings文件:在項目中創建一個名為Localizable.st
要在SwiftUI中實現下拉刷新功能,您可以使用ScrollView和OnRefreshableViewModifier。以下是一個示例代碼,演示如何實現下拉刷新功能: import SwiftUI
要實現模態彈出窗口,可以使用SwiftUI的sheet modifier。以下是一個簡單的示例代碼: struct ContentView: View { @State private var
是的,SwiftUI支持國際化。您可以使用SwiftUI的Localizable.strings文件來存儲不同語言的文本,并根據用戶的語言設置來顯示相應的文本。您可以使用LocalizedString